Complexes of Usher proteins preassemble at the endoplasmic reticulum and are required for trafficking and ER homeostasis
Usher syndrome (USH), the leading cause of hereditary combined hearing and vision loss, is characterized by sensorineural deafness and progressive retinal degeneration.
